I agree that this season we are a great watch, lots of goals, nice football, exciting even! However we are up against significantly weaker teams than Saints, hence we look good. Go back up to the top flight and we will be the Swansea or Sheffield Wednesday that we have enjoyed playing this season for the top half teams next season. How much money we could afford to spend will be critical to us even having half a chance of staying up - THB, Downes, Fraser, Brooks, Rothwell, and I’m sure some I have forgotten (?) are all on loan. I’d say the first four are absolute must sign players assuming we go up. We also absolutely would need another striker to replace Che, and they don’t come cheap. Adam Armstrong is also a proven non prolific scorer at prem level so would almost certainly need upgrading too… What would the loan 4, plus 2 strikers cost to sign? £100 million +? Playing possession based football when you’re a top side in the championship is one thing, playing like that against top prem sides - very different proposition. Virtually every playing out from the back mistake would be punished with a goal. Last night we’d have conceded two from errors playing out against a decent prem side. This season is fun because we are the bigger fish in the pond, go back up and it would be a season long struggle with some absolute hammerings in it. I cringe at times this season at how ‘tight’ we play it out from the back and at the top table we would be relentlessly punished playing like that. I’m loving this season, we must go back up now, or we will lose most of our decent players and become also rans again like most of the championship. Fingers crossed for promotion, but I’m really not sure how we’d cope without a big cash spend and a little (lot) of luck! Lets hope we find out 🤞

Well that was exciting! Eight goals and we didn’t lose - I think a draw was a fair result overall. As mentioned our defending was terrible, we have got to sort out our dead ball defending - we look like conceding at every free kick/ corner around the box. Our side is physically small, we don’t have much height in the side and we struggle because of it. No height up front at all - we get into some nice wide positions around the box in attack, and then have to play it along the ground as there is no physical presence at all. Oh for a Pellé type attacking focus. I though Norwich broke at pace and looked dangerous, we always looked vulnerable to their counter attacks. Bazunu could not be blamed for the goals - terrible defending for all of them. I really don’t know what the solution at the back is other than replacing both CB’s which isn’t going to happen. No pace in them, poor positioning, non existent marking we will concede a fair few goals. Definitely going to have some high scoring games - could be a long wait for our first clean sheet! Enjoyed it, nice to rescue it at the end (kudos Adam Armstrong) kept cool with a good pair of pens, good atmosphere - dare I say it was exciting?! Certainly better than the turgid dog turd we played at home last season. Get a big centre back who can organise, a DM who can get stuck in and break up play, and a focus upfront with some physical presence and we will do ok.
